We collect, evaluate, analyze, and document information on direct losses to civilian infrastructure caused by the Russian aggression. Run by Kyiv School of Economics. On February 24, 2022, Russia launched a full-scale unprovoked war against Ukraine. During the war, hundreds of schools, kindergartens, hospitals, cultural institutions, hundreds of bridges, a dozen airports, thousands of square meters of residential buildings, and the world's largest airplane, the Mriya, have been destroyed or damaged. The amount of direct losses to Ukraine's economy due to the destruction and damage to civilian and military infrastructure is already estimated at tens of billions of dollars. This project collects, evaluates, and analyzes information on material losses of citizens and the state from the war with Russia. Since the first days of the war, in February 2022, the project has been implemented by the KSE Institute (a think tank at the Kyiv School of Economics) in cooperation with the Office of the President of Ukraine, the Ministry of Economy, the Ministry of Reintegration of the Temporarily Occupied Territories, and the Ministry of Infrastructure of Ukraine.
